Honestly, a way more heartwarming tale than I thought it’d be. And that might be because I’m a bit jaded about my own hometown. But I admit defeat and mushy gushy feelings when I feel them. And this book definitely has those. 
My biggest gripe has to do with the competition plot itself. Kinda boring. And I’d a bit tired of these magical competitions. More curses and hexes please! (Although you can argue that we have enough of those in the other books in this series)
But Emmy does have a pretty great character arc. You go girl
